I just found the first problem (probably a BIOS bug):
ATIF_FUNCTION_GET_SYSTEM_PARAMETERS is implemented in the DSDT, but the
corresponding bit ATIF_GET_SYSTEM_PARAMETERS_SUPPORTED is not set :(
I intended to use the method to set up the notification handler but now
my BIOS says that it's not there even if it is...
Can I assume some default values (e.g. notifications are enabled and will
use 0x81 unless ATIF_FUNCTION_GET_SYSTEM_PARAMETERS says something
different)?
